			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>It has literally been ages since my last run. I think it might have been all the way back in October when I decided to stop running Palo Duro after my second loop. My base mileage wasn&#8217;t good then and it&#8217;s even worse now. Of course, it wasn&#8217;t so hot when I ran Lean Horse 50M in August, either, but anyways&#8230;</p>
<p>I&#8217;ve picked out my first race to enter, the <a href="http://www.earlblewett.net/lmtr.htm">Lake McMurtry Trail Runs</a> over in Stillwater on April 19th. Today I mailed in my entry for the 25K which should still be a formidable challenge given that I haven&#8217;t been running since I got to Tulsa. I&#8217;ve got to get at it this weekend which is why I picked up a new pair of trail shoes tonight. After the blister disaster at Lean Horse with the Montrail Hardrock, I&#8217;ve decided to go with the New Balance 608.</p>
<p>And I couldn&#8217;t move to Tulsa without joining the local trail running club. I am now member #160 in the <a href="http://tatur.org">Tulsa Area Trail &amp; Ultra Runners</a> club.</p>
